Tuesday, August 20, 2013
John was coming over to do a final ride with me and leave me with ‘The Rocket’, his light-weight, carbon-fiber racing bike.  I was planning on bringing both Big Red and The Rocket in the van in the event I had issues with UB Express (bikes MUST be named).  My repair skills are limited, as are the opportunities to visit bike stores on the Tour, so the more I’m carrying as back up, the better.

We rode on the Waite Hill course, but John begged off having to climb the final hill from Squires Castle up to Chardon Road on River Road.

“That thing killed me Sunday.  Can we please skip it?” he asked.

“You need the conditioning.  If we skip it, you’ll only regret it later,” I said, trying to shame him into riding it.

In the end, I let him off easy and skipped the hill, shortening the ride by 4 miles.  We arrived back home in under two hours and took a cleansing dip in the neighbor’s pool before moving inside to make another amazing smoothie.  I wish I had an extra blender for the trip.  I’d pack it in the van, put smoothie ingredients in a cooler and whip one up at the end of each day.  Maybe next time.

After John left, I returned to my maps and computer and put the final touches on the cycling course.  Tomorrow – packing begins in earnest.

Bike duration:  One hour and 53 minutes.
Training Heart Rate:  120 bpm.
Calories burned during workout:  1650.
